RADIO MAKING THE FARMER A STAR

We listen to it in corner shops, cars, at work and at home—an entire audio world is open to us. Everything from pop music and ball-games to news and weather every 15 minutes.

The ubiquitous radio has a special role for farmers in Arusha, Tanzania. Sarika Bansal writes in a piece for The New York Times that in sub-Saharan Africa, four times as many farmers have access to the radio as to cell phones and they are putting them to good use.
